1 DEVELOPMENT AGREEMENT BETWEEN CITY OF MIAMI, FLORIDA AND CG MIAMI RIVER OWNER, LLC, REGARDING APPROVAL OF THE MIAMI RIVER SPECIAL AREA PLAN AND RELATED DEVELOPMENT This is a Development Agreement ( Agreement ) made this day 2013, between CG Miami River Owner, LLC, a Florida corporation, (the Developer ) and the City of Miami, Florida, a municipal corporation and a political subdivision of the State of Florida (the City ) (the Developer and the City together referred to as the Parties ). WHEREAS, the Developer is the fee simple owner of the property in Miami-Dade County, Florida, legally described on Exhibit A, located between SW 7 Street on the south, the Miami River on the north, SW 2 Avenue on the east, and SW 3 Avenue on the west, within the City (the Property ); and WHEREAS, the Property amounts to approximately 6.2 acres of land; and WHEREAS, the Property is designated Industrial / Port of Miami River and Restricted Commercial on the Future Land Use Map, according to the Miami Comprehensive Neighborhood Plan ("Comprehensive Plan"); and WHEREAS, the Property is zoned D3 Waterfront Industrial and T6-36B-O Urban Core, according to the Miami 21 Zoning Code ("Miami 21") WHEREAS, a process exists within Miami 21 which allows parcels of more than nine (9) abutting acres to be master planned to allow greater integration of public improvements and infrastructure, and greater flexibility so as to result in higher or specialized quality building and streetscape design; and WHEREAS, the result of this master planning process is known as a "Special Area Plan" ("SAP"); and WHEREAS, on August, 2014, the Developer filed an application with the City for approval of a SAP in order to develop the Property as a mixed use development with residential and lodging units, retail, restaurants, working waterfront uses, office, and other amenities, including a public riverwalk (the Miami River SAP ); and WHEREAS, the City serves as co-applicant for approval of the Miami River SAP, as fee simple owner of the land described in Exhibit B ( City SAP Area ), approximately 2.9 acres, including the public right of ways, and portions of Jose Marti Park; and WHEREAS, the entirety of the SAP application area amounts to approximately 9.1 acres, legally described on Exhibit C ( SAP Application Area ); and WHEREAS, the City and the Developer wish for development of the Miami River SAP to proceed in a manner which is consistent with the Comprehensive Plan, Miami 21, the City 1

2 Charter, the Miami River Greenway Action Plan, and the Miami River Corridor Urban Infill Plan ; and WHEREAS, as a condition to the approval of the Project, the Developer must enter into a Development Agreement pursuant to Section f. of Miami 21. Public Benefits. The Project consists of five (5) phases of development on the Property. Four (4) of the phases will take advantage of additional Benefit Height and Floor Lot Ratio ( FLR ) as permitted under Miami 21. Phases 1, 3, and 5 will contain approximately 340,800 square feet of benefit floor area each; Phase 5 will contain approximately 242,400 square feet of benefit floor area. Based on the City s development fee schedule, the price per square foot of benefit area is approximately $ Accordingly, the total estimated Benefit contribution to the City will be approximately $22,000,000. In lieu of the cash contribution to the Miami 21 Public Benefits Trust Fund, the Developer shall construct improvements within the SAP Area and its surroundings pursuant to the Project plans and the traffic analysis prepared for the project by Kimley Horn & Associates, dated August 15, 2014, and such improvements 3

4 authorized by the City administration. A list of proposed improvements currently under consideration by the City is attached as Exhibit F. These proposed improvements include connection of the riverwalk, in accordance with the Miami River Greenway Action Plan and the Miami River Corridor Urban Infill Plan, from the SW 2 Avenue Bridge through the northwest boundary of Jose Marti Park at SW 2 Street. The Developer agrees that the riverwalk improvements shall be constructed as part of Phase 2 of the Project s development. It should be noted that the improvements proposed in Exhibit F present a selection of possible improvements, subject to review and approval by the required governmental entities. 9. Working Waterfront. The portion of the Property currently zoned D3, and designated as Industrial on the City s Future Land Use Atlas, shall maintain a Working Waterfront use. Therefore, the Developer: (a) shall not to object or otherwise attempt to impede any legally permitted Working Waterfront 24-hour operations; (b) shall provide all future tenants and prospective owners of the Property notice of the existing Working Waterfront 24- hour operations and will include a provision to agree not to object to legally permitted Working Waterfront 24-hour operations in each lease; (c) acknowledges that it is solely the Developer's responsibility to design its structures to accommodate legally permitted Working Waterfront 24- hour operations; and (d) will not pursue any claims for liability, loss or damage, whether through litigation or otherwise, against permittees engaging in Working Waterfront 24-hour operations, related to damage to Owner's structures, noise, smoke, fumes, bridge closures, and/or other quality of life issues that might result from legally permitted Working Waterfront 24-hour operations. 10. Riverwalk. The Developer, at its sole cost and expense, agrees to develop the public Riverwalk between SW 2 Avenue and the western boundary of Jose Marti Park, SW 2 Street, as part of Phase II of the project development. A Riverwalk shall be built, constructed, installed and maintained substantially in compliance with the plans as depicted in the Phase II plans. Substantially in compliance shall be determined by the City Planning Director. The Riverwalk on the Property will be open to the public and maintained by the Developer. 11. Valet Parking. The Developer intends to establish a uniform valet system to service the SAP Application Area. Notwithstanding the limitations set forth in Sections , a maximum of two (2) valet permits may be issued for the operation of a valet parking ramp on the same side of the block where the permit applicant is the operator of the uniform valet system. 14. Alcoholic Beverage Sales. The Property is located within the D-3 and T6-36B- O zoning transects as designated under Miami 21. Notwithstanding the requirements of Section of the City Code, Planning and Zoning Advisory Board, and City Commission approval shall not be required for bars (including taverns, pubs, and lounges), nightclubs, supper clubs as principal uses proposed to be located within the Project. Said establishments shall be authorized pursuant to the issuance of a Warrant (currently requires Exception). The Planning & Zoning Director shall consider the criteria set forth in Section of the City Code when evaluating such Warrant applications. 15. Environmental. The City finds that the proposed development will confer a significant net improvement upon the publicly accessible tree canopy in the area. The City and the Developer agree that the Developer will comply with the intent and requirements of Chapter 5

6 17 of the City Code by performing tree replacement within the SAP Area where possible. Where replacement within the SAP Area is not possible, the Developer shall perform tree replacement within Jose Marti Park. Where replacement within Jose Marti Park is not possible, the Developer shall perform the required tree replacement within one (1) mile of the SAP or within any other City park, subject to approval by the City. The City further agrees to facilitate the permitting and planting of replacement trees on all publicly owned property within the area and within City parks. 16. Public Facilities. 14 Miami River Proposed Public Benefits* Benefit Description Estimate Public Riverwalk Jose Marti Park Greenlink Public Streetscapes Miami Riverside Center Public Open Space at 460 SW 2 Avenue 2.5 Avenue (Miami River Promenade) Public Plazas Trolley Stop Traffic I-95 Overpass and SW 2 Avenue Bridge Bike Lane Developer will construct a connected Riverwalk beginning at SW 2 Avenue Bridge and continuing through Jose Marti Park in compliance with Miami River Greenway Action Plan and the Miami River Corridor Urban Infill Plan. Developer will improve ADA access throughout the Riverwalk where none exists today. Developer will create a pedestrian pathway from the Riverwalk to the intersection of SW 4th Avenue and SW 2 Avenue in order to provide public access through the park to the Riverwalk. Developer will construct a public canoe launch. Developer will renovate bathrooms adjacent to pool. Developer will contribute funding for development of and connection to Greenlink Project. Developer will construct a unified streetscape consisting of cohesive landscaping, hardscaping, and street furniture along SW 7th Street, SW 6th Street, SW 5th Street, and SW 3rd Avenue within the proximity of the SAP area. Developer will improve Miami Riverside Center public open space with landscaping, hardscaping and street furniture (benches, receptacles, bollards) consistent with improvements proposed for the SAP area. Developer will construct a pedestrian and vehicular crossblock passage with a cohesive streetscape that grants public access through the center of the Property, directly to the Miami River and additional public spaces within the Riverwalk promenade. Developer will create public plazas, viewing and access areas along the Miami River, ancillary and adjacent to the Riverwalk promenade. Developer will coordinate with the City of Miami to ensure the siting of a trolley stop on the Property. Developer will improve SW 4th Avenue/I-95 SB off-ramp at the intersection with SW 7th Avenue in coordination with $1,800,000 $975,000 TBD with City of Miami $2,500,000 $450,000 $750,000 $800,000 TBD with City of Miami $1,250,000 FDOT. Developer will introduce up-lighting to improve safety and encourage public access. $100,000 Developer will create bike access along SW 2 Avenue, along the Miami River, and along SW 3rd Avenue between SW 6th Street and the River. *Subject to Miami City Commission approval and permit issuance from all applicable governmental agencies. $300,000
